Transaction 3aa9e4ff75a3876852dbfcd741040690dd33e6cae41b660b65566faca910666d
1 Input
1 Output
-
3aa9e4ff75a3876852dbfcd741040690dd33e6cae41b660b65566faca910666d:0
- value
- 666267
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8462b6bb4dc1cc3fa2a4ac64f0aa24dff8d97397 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D4zT5RurC9FDBLk7yYokCMMno9DXj4dBg